Property Details for 19/27 Tor Rd, Dee Why

19/27 Tor Rd, Dee Why is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om Townhouse with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1973. The property has a land size of 3895m2 and floor size of 120m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in March 2011.

About Dee Why 2099

The size of Dee Why is approximately 3.4 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 15.0% of total area. The population of Dee Why in 2016 was 21518 people. By 2021 the population was 23354 showing a population growth of 8.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Dee Why is 30-39 years. Households in Dee Why are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Dee Why work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 50.20% of the homes in Dee Why were owner-occupied compared with 50.30% in 2016.

Dee Why has 13,166 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Dee Why have seen a 48.51%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 36.42% increase. As at 31 December 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Dee Why is $2,842,845 while the median value for Units is $1,114,910.
  • Houses have a median rent of $775 while Units have a median rent of $775.
